Montana v. Imlay

Montana v. Imlay
Supreme Court of the United States · Decided October 5, 1992
506 U.S. 807 (United States Reports)

Montana v. Imlay

Opinion of the Court

Sup. Ct. Mont. [Certiorari granted, 503 U. S. 905.] Motion of respondent for leave to proceed further herein in forma pauperis granted. Motion for appointment of counsel nunc pro tunc granted, and it is ordered that Billy B. Miller, Esq., of Great Falls, Mont., be appointed to serve as counsel for respondent in this case. Motion of petitioner to strike supplemental brief of respondent denied.
